Neighborhood

With its wide brick sidewalks, mature trees, elegant boutiques, and outdoor dining, Downtown Gainesville celebrates its Southern charm with down-home style. There's even a historic town square with a statue and benches. Gainesville is located along the popular Lake Lanier, a resort destination known for boating, fishing, swimming, and Lanier World water park. It is also a college town, home to Brenau University and the University of North Georgia - Gainesville Campus.

Downtown Gainesville hosts a wide variety of events and festivals. There's the Spring Chicken Festival, held on the Square and featuring an art market and live music. The highlight of this festival is its chicken -- this is the state's only official chicken cook-off. It also features a unique "Re-Hatched" market -- an arts and crafts market that features artwork made from recycled items. Other events include the Rubber Duck Derby, First Friday summer concerts, and a downtown Beach Bash.
